In a water softening system, which component is regenerated by the brine solution?

Explanation:
The main idea is that the resin used to soften water is recharged by a brine solution. In a water softener, the softening medium is an ion-exchange resin that captures calcium and magnesium from hard water in exchange for sodium ions. Over time the resin becomes saturated with hardness ions and can’t soften further. A concentrated brine solution is then drawn through the resin bed; the high sodium ion concentration pushes the exchange reaction, displacing calcium and magnesium and restoring the resin to its sodium form. After regeneration, a rinse flushes out the displaced hardness minerals and any excess brine. The other components aren’t regenerated by brine—chlorination handles disinfection, filtration media are cleansed or replaced rather than regenerated with brine, and the storage tank simply holds water.
